When should I start fishing frogs?

Asked: Guy Lafrenière, Last Updated:

The best time to throw frog lures for bass is from early summer through early fall for most of the country. Southern anglers may see success with frogs in late spring. Once water temperatures hit about 68° and up, a frog can be a really good bait rain or shine until the first frost in fall.

  • Do fish die when they stop swimming?

    Do fish die if they stop swimming? Your average fish can breathe perfectly fine, however, both in motion and at rest, so long as the water is oxygenated sufficiently. They will not die if they stop swimming. Simply being in oxygenated water is enough for fish to breathe and survive.

  • What is shrimp powder used for?

    One excellent use is a small amount added to fried rice, but shrimp powder does need to be used in moderation due to its strong flavour and aroma. A pinch is usually enough. A small amount will also intensify any seafood-based noodle soup, such as lakhsa, and it works very well with coconut-based dishes too.
